The Administrative Core of the CADC is the central
organizational unit that coordinates and supports the work of the
Investigator
Development, Measurement and Community Liaison Cores. The goals
of the Administrative Core reflect the overall goals of the Center.
1. To sustain and expand the organizational structure and expertise
of the CADC at UCSF to continue to foster the development of minority
investigators who will conduct research with older minority persons
based on the research focus of healthy aging and disease prevention.
2. To support the recruitment and retention of minority group members
in health promotion, epidemiological, social, behavioral and biomedical
research dealing with the health of older adults.
3. To coordinate the CADC work in order to synthesize research
findings, methodological developments, and overall progress in
promoting the focus on healthy aging and disease prevention to
reduce health disparities.
4. To coordinate the activities of the CADC cores through a network
of investigators and community leaders in order to promote community-based
participatory research.
